If you're on chrome check your adress bar. On the right if there's a small symbol crossed by a red bar, click it and select allow flash player and reload the page. The badge should now count your kills from now on.

Best unit would probably be the cuccoo, just fly straight to the end portal on each level, then switch to any melee character to easily finish any of the dragons and final boss. :)
